Output 523f888439d007aeb3656fb1c96fcd56f5f3d2b112be880200dca0c11ba00f40:45

value
340915
script pubkey
OP_0 OP_PUSHBYTES_20 a3cc7df9290741edc05ed8d10714ed99e107e7e8
address
bc1q50x8m7ffqaq7msz7mrgsw98dn8ss0elg6zplyq
transaction
523f888439d007aeb3656fb1c96fcd56f5f3d2b112be880200dca0c11ba00f40
confirmations
128133
spent
true